Yeah, they do largely fit into pairs:

BJ / 7800 - Darker, grittier pop/rock/metal
SWW / NJ - Stadium sized anthemic 80s rock
KTF / TD - More blues and hard rock edged, more grown up but still incredibly passionate
Crush / Bounce - Both somewhat hit-and-miss attempts to experiment with contemporary sounds, and remain relevant in a changed musical landscape

Then HAND, which saw them settling comfortably into a modern commercial rock style ... which, while it did make for the most consistent post - 2000 album up to that point, also made it the most "safe" of the three

Then LH .... basically adult contemporary music with a bit of classic BJ pop-rock and a bit of country influence

So I guess the HAND / LH pairing is something like: radio friendly modern pop-rock
